Mary Marie (Lance) Robinson, 86, of Mill Spring, died Wednesday, October 30, 2024 at Hendersonville Health and Rehab in Flat Rock.
Born in Henderson County, she was the wife of the late Frank Robinson, and the daughter of the late Hall Bert and Magnolia (Pinner) Lance. She was also preceded in death by a brother, Albert Lance, and a sister, Dorothy Allen.
Mary is survived by two sons: Gary Frank Robinson and his wife Clarissa of Mill Spring, and Lemuel Lee Robinson of Addison, ME; three grandchildren: William Robinson (Samantha), Kyna Harrill (Andrew), and Skye Rhodes-Robinson; and five great-grandchildren: Caroline, Remington, Daphne, Brynleigh, and Briar; and a number of nieces and nephews.
To honor Mary’s request, services will be private.
In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to the American Cancer Society, Elizabeth House, or the charity of your choice.
Groce Funeral Home at Lake Julian is assisting the family.
